Population Policy

The Fourth National Economic and Social Development Plan
 (1977-1981). Part II, Chapter V, p.105.

 


Date:
    1977-1981

Source:     Office of the Prime Minister, National Economic and Social Development Board, Bangkok, Thailand

Subject:     population policy, population distribution

Text:

2.2  Population Distribution Policies

2.2.1  The migration rates to the Bangkok-Thonburi region and to other urban areas in some provinces must be reduced.

2.2.2  Measures to stimulate and support the migration out of the Bangkok-Thonburi area into adjacent areas and other provinces.

2.2.3  Intra-regional migration is to be supported more than interregional migration.

2.2.4  With respect to rural-urban migration, support should be given to the flow of migrants into the principal urban centres of each region, in line with the guidelines laid down for regional development.

2.2.5  The influx of refugees, particularly those from neighbouring countries, should be halted. Those who have already entered Thailand should be encouraged to return to their homelands or to other third countries.
